Baylor-Vanderbilt: First Half Thoughts

Related Topics: Jalen Hurd

Baylor trails Vanderbilt 21-17.

Here are four thoughts on the half:

1) Denzel Mims has been awesome- I don’t understand why Vanderbilt has given him single coverage so often. Without Jalen Hurd, it was obvious Baylor would target him. He had 61 yards on his two receptions, and if not for Sam Tecklenburg being downfield (they incorrectly said it was on Blake Blackmar), he’d have had even more yards.

2) Big plays kill this defense, again- Vanderbilt scored on a 65 yard screen on 3rd and 10. On the third drive, they scored on a 68 yard run.
